DESCRIPTION:This unforgettable night with one of Broadway's most celebrated talents will feature songs from Laura’s career together with humorous anecdotes about her experiences on and off the stage and screen. \n** Limited premium VIP seating available (limit 60 seats)\, inclusive of a private\, COVID-safe\, post-performance event with Laura Benanti. ** \nAccolades: \n“Supreme command\, a thrilling voice and a wild sense of humor combines to make Laura Benanti’s show a sensation.” – The New York Times \n“Benanti’s ridiculous range and exuberant talent lets her roam seamlessly through the musical landscape in a way that few other performers working today can.” – The Daily Beast \nAbout Laura Benanti: \nTony Award winner and five-time Tony Award nominee Laura Benanti is a highly celebrated stage and screen actress\, who recently ended her critically acclaimed run on Broadway as Eliza Doolittle in Lincoln Center’s revival of My Fair Lady. Her television credits include: “Younger”; “The Detour”; “Supergirl”; “Law & Order: SVU”; “Nashville”; “The Good Wife“; "Elementary”; “Nurse Jackie"; “The Big C”; NBC’s “The Sound of Music Live”; and her heralded turn as First Lady Melania Trump on “The Late Show with Stephen Colbert.” Other Broadway credits include Steve Martin’s Meteor Shower; Amalia Balash in She Loves Me (Tony and Drama Desk Award nomination); Gypsy Rose Lee in Gypsy opposite Patti LuPone (Tony\, Drama Desk and Outer Critics Circle award winner); Women on the Verge of a Nervous Breakdown (Tony nomination\, Drama Desk and Outer Critics Circle award winner); Into the Woods (Tony\, Drama Desk\, Outer Critics Circle nominations); In the Next Room or The Vibrator Play; The Wedding Singer; and Nine (starring Antonio Banderas). Other distinguished theater performances include: Perdita in The Winter's Tale at the Williamstown Theatre Festival; Anne in A Little Night Music at the L.A. Opera; Eileen in Wonderful Town; and Rosabella in The Most Happy Fella\, both for City Center Encores! \n— \nThis event is presented by Worcester-based producer and artist\, Eric Butler. \n#broadwayinworcester #LauraBenanti

DESCRIPTION:Calling all community musicians with diverse musical & cultural traditions and music enthusiasts!  \nHosted by Arts Transcending Borders at the College of the Holy Cross\, renowned Brazilian percussionist Cyro Baptista arrives at JMAC/Worcester PopUp to lead Sounds of Community workshops\, building towards a final performance at the JMAC/Brickbox with Baptista’s winsome quartet\, the Banquet of Spirits\, and community participants. As part of his week-long residency\, Cyro Baptista will lead workshops with a variety of community groups and participants\, using everyday objects as well as traditional instruments. This performance is the culmination of the residency and includes community participation. \nA veteran of stage and studio work with the likes of Paul Simon\, Herbie Hancock\, Yo-Yo Ma\, Trey Anastasio (of Phish)\, Sting\, the New York Philharmonic\, Wynton Marsalis and the Jazz at Lincoln Center Orchestra\, and many others\, Baptista is one of the most sought-after players around. His visionary approach to music-making stresses inclusion\, community and pushing past boundaries\, while remaining refreshingly fun and totally accessible. His technique of using his body\, spare parts of kitchenware\, anything that’s out of the ordinary and traditional instruments\, makes his workshops a truly unique and entertaining experience. \nFree and open to the general public. DESCRIPTION:In 2000\, Gary Mullen won ITV’s “Stars In Their Eyes” Live Grand Final\, with the largest number of votes ever received in the shows history.  The record of 864\,838 votes was more than twice that of the runner-up.  Gary began touring on his own and in 2002 formed a band ‘The Works’\, to pay tribute to rock legends Queen.  Since May 2002\, ‘Gary Mullen and the Works’ have performed throughout the UK\, USA\, Europe\, South Africa and New Zealand to sell-out audiences.  The outfit have also twice rocked the prestigious BBC Proms in the Park\, in front of a very enthusiastic crowd of 40\,000. One Night of Queen is a spectacular live concert\, recreating the look\, sound\, pomp and showmanship of arguably the greatest rock band of all time.
